CES 2024: World’s first transparent TV unveiled

The biggest tech event of the year, Consumer Electronics Show (CES) 2024 has started in Las Vegas, America. In this, South Korean company LG introduced the world’s first transparent OLED TV. Apart from this, products like flying car and 2 in 1 laptop have also been introduced.

More than 1.30 lakh people are expected to attend CES 2024. In this event which runs till January 12, more than 4000 companies from all over the world are showcasing modern electronic equipment. 35% of the companies participating in it are American.

South Korean company LG has introduced the world’s first transparent OLED TV. It has a 77-inch glass display. Due to this, the images displayed on the screen appear to be floating in the air. LG Signature OLED TV will be available globally later this year.

LG says that it becomes invisible when closed. The TV comes with a Zero Connect box, which transmits video and audio to the display panel on the TV with the help of wireless technology. Samsung has also introduced Micro LED-powered transparent TV at the event.

XPeng Aero HT has introduced its flying car at CES 2024. While sharing updates on the progress of this car, the company said that the car presented here will be mass produced in 2025. However, before that, the company will start pre-orders for the modular EV/ eVTOL combo from the fourth quarter of this year.

The fully-electric piloted aircraft is capable of vertical takeoff/landing and low altitude flights. It supports manual and autonomous flight modes. The 270° panoramic two-person cockpit offers a wide field of view.

Hyundai’s advanced air mobility company Supernaval unveiled its electric flying taxi at this year’s CES. The S-A2 is an elect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) vehicle. The S-A2 is a V-tail electric aircraft that can fly at 120 mph at an altitude of 1,500 feet. It is designed for a journey of 50-60 Km.

It has eight tilting rotors and a distributed electric propulsion system. The company says it will “operate as quiet as a dishwasher” with 65 dB during vertical takeoff and landing and 45 dB during cruising. Supernaval plans to officially launch the vehicle in 2028.

Samsung introduced futuristic foldable phone. This is being called ‘flex in and out’. This concept device can rotate 360 degrees both forward and backward.

Samsung says that the panel of this foldable device has been folded and other tests have been done in temperatures ranging from -20 degrees Celsius to 60 degrees Celsius. Basketballs were bounced on foldable panels and then dunked in water by rubbing them with sand.

Lenovo has introduced 2 in 1 laptop ‘ThinkBook Plus Gen 5 Hybrid’. In this, users will get Windows as well as Android operating system. When you use it in laptop mode, it will work like a laptop. As soon as you remove its display, it transforms into an Android tablet.
